Sell it on Craigslist locally for whatever you think it's worth or Amazon nationally/internationally. It's easy and you get to choose whatever you want to get out of it. If you are really not worried about the price, you can probably get about $200 for it depending on what you are going to include with it. If you have extra controllers, games, a hard drive etc..
Obviously, anywhere you sell it to a place that is going to resell it, YOU ARE NOT GOING TO GET WHAT IT IS REALLY WORTH! They need to make a profit, so you sell it straight to the consumer for the value of what Gamestop or a pawn shop will sell it for (so no you shouldn't sell it to a pawn shopt)!
